AIR QUALITY MODELING: ANALYST / SCIENTIST PSE HEALTHY ENERGY
ORGANIZATION
PSE Healthy Energy is a non-profit energy science and policy research institute dedicated to supplying evidence- based scientific information and resources on the environmental, public health, social equity, and climate dimensions of energy production and use. Our work focuses on oil and gas, power plants, renewable energy, energy storage, and energy transitions. Much of our positive, dedicated, and high-functioning team is based out of our headquarters in Oakland, CA with staff also located across the United States.
PSE's mission is to bring scientific transparency and clarity to energy policy discussions, helping to level the playing field between communities, the media, policymakers, and the private sector by generating, translating, and disseminating scientific information. No other interdisciplinary collaboration of physicians, scientists, and engineers exists to focus specifically on issues of health and sustainability at the intersection of energy science and policy.
POSITION
PSE Healthy Energy is seeking a full-time air quality modeling analyst/scientist to assist and collaborate with PSE scientists and senior scientists in evaluations of how energy choices impact outdoor and indoor air quality and public health. Energy systems of interest include, but are not limited to upstream, midstream and downstream oil and gas sectors, electricity transmission and distribution, gas- and coal-fired power generation, carbon management and the integration of multiple cleaner energy technologies in energy transitions. Strong candidates will have demonstrated experience in air modeling and data analysis including the capability to extract, organize, clean, analyze and interpret datasets from multiple sources and synthesize existing studies on the environmental, health and climate dimensions of energy production and use.
The position requires creativity, initiative, independent work and collaboration while thinking strategically about complex scientific research and issues related to energy and energy policy, renewable energy, public health, and the environment. It is not expected that a single candidate will have expertise across all these areas- we're seeking candidates that are particularly strong in a few areas and have some interest and capabilities in others.
